Lipid layer enhancers are redefining dry eye care by stabilizing the tear film, improving comfort, and elevating expectations for efficacy and usability
Lipid layer enhancers have moved from being a niche adjunct in dry eye management to a strategically important category that intersects patient adherence, device-free convenience, and expanding clinical expectations. As digital lifestyles increase blink disruption and evaporative stress, and as aging demographics elevate meibomian gland dysfunction prevalence, formulators and brand owners are prioritizing products that stabilize the tear film and reduce tear evaporation without compromising comfort or vision.This executive summary frames the category through the lens of product science and commercialization realities. The core value proposition is straightforward: restore or augment the outer lipid layer of the tear film to improve ocular surface stability. Yet, the competitive terrain is complex. Products now span prescription and non-prescription pathways, increasingly combine lipids with humectants or anti-inflammatory-supportive excipients, and rely on sophisticated delivery systems that must remain tolerable for frequent use.
At the same time, stakeholder expectations are evolving. Eye care professionals want predictable symptom relief and better patient persistence. Retail and e-commerce channels seek differentiated claims that remain compliant. Manufacturers must secure stable supplies for specialized lipids, emulsifiers, and packaging components while maintaining sterility, shelf-life, and patient-friendly sensory profiles. Consequently, the market is entering a phase where scientific credibility, manufacturing discipline, and channel strategy determine winners.

Innovation, preservative-free delivery, subtype-specific dry eye management, and omnichannel buying are reshaping how lipid layer enhancers compete and win
The landscape for lipid layer enhancers is undergoing transformative shifts driven by a convergence of clinical science, consumer behavior, and regulatory pragmatism. First, the clinical conversation around dry eye is increasingly subtype-specific. Practitioners are differentiating evaporative dry eye from aqueous-deficient presentations and tailoring therapy accordingly, which raises the bar for lipid-focused products to demonstrate clear patient-reported benefit and compatibility with common comorbidities such as blepharitis and allergy.Second, formulation innovation is accelerating beyond traditional oil-in-water emulsions. Microemulsion architectures, refined droplet-size control, and surfactant systems designed to reduce blur and stinging are being used to improve sensory performance. In parallel, there is growing interest in lipid blends that more closely mimic native meibum behavior, including improved spreading and film persistence. This shift is also shaping how brands communicate differentiation, moving from generic “lubrication” language toward more precise tear film stabilization narratives.
Third, preservative and container choices are becoming a strategic differentiator rather than a technical footnote. Heightened awareness of ocular surface sensitivity is pushing adoption of preservative-free formats, whether via single-dose units or advanced multi-dose systems that maintain sterility without traditional preservatives. These packaging decisions influence cost, supply chain risk, and channel fit, especially for high-frequency users.
Fourth, the route-to-market is expanding as consumers increasingly self-triage eye discomfort and purchase solutions through retail and online channels. That behavior creates opportunity for strong branding and education, but it also introduces friction: shoppers face crowded shelves and must understand why a lipid-focused product differs from standard artificial tears. As a result, brands are investing in clearer indication pathways, content-driven education, and clinician advocacy to bridge the knowledge gap.
Finally, the competitive field is being shaped by broader healthcare trends. Telehealth consultations, subscription-based replenishment models, and growing adoption of at-home supportive regimens are shifting the emphasis toward consistent, repeatable user experiences. Taken together, these changes are transforming lipid layer enhancers into a category where product performance, evidence quality, packaging engineering, and omnichannel storytelling must work in lockstep.
United States tariffs in 2025 amplify supply chain risk for lipids and packaging, forcing tougher decisions on sourcing, validation, pricing, and SKU stability
The cumulative impact of United States tariffs in 2025 is best understood through the practical realities of a globally distributed supply chain. Lipid layer enhancer products often rely on internationally sourced inputs, including specialty lipids, surfactants, emulsifiers, bottle resins, dispensing components, cartons, and sometimes contract manufacturing capacity. When tariffs raise landed costs for any of these elements, the effects ripple across formulation choices, packaging formats, and pricing architecture.One immediate pressure point is cost absorption versus price pass-through. In consumer health categories, brands are often constrained by retail price thresholds and promotional cadence. If component costs rise due to tariffs, manufacturers may attempt to protect margins by reformulating, requalifying alternate suppliers, renegotiating contracts, or shifting production steps geographically. However, ocular products are highly sensitive to change control; even minor alterations to excipients or packaging can trigger additional validation work and may require updated regulatory documentation. This reality makes quick pivots challenging and can slow response times.
A second implication is risk concentration in packaging and dispensing systems. Preservative-free strategies frequently depend on specialized single-dose formats or multi-dose valve technologies. If tariffs affect plastics, precision-molded parts, or finished packaging assemblies, the downstream consequence can be constrained availability or longer lead times. That can influence channel service levels and encourage brands to prioritize core SKUs, potentially limiting assortment breadth.
Third, tariff-driven volatility can shift negotiating power within the value chain. Suppliers with domestic capacity may gain leverage, while import-dependent suppliers may face demand for cost-sharing. Brand owners with diversified sourcing and dual-qualified materials can respond more decisively, whereas smaller firms may experience disproportionate disruption. Over time, this dynamic can encourage consolidation of supply partnerships and motivate strategic investments in local manufacturing or regionalized finishing.
Finally, tariffs can indirectly reshape competitive positioning. Companies that manage to preserve preservative-free offerings, maintain quality consistency, and stabilize pricing will likely improve trust with both clinicians and consumers. Conversely, frequent out-of-stocks or sudden formula changes can erode loyalty in a category where comfort and predictability drive repeat use. The net effect in 2025 is not merely higher costs; it is a sharper premium on supply chain resilience, disciplined change management, and transparent channel coordination.
Segmentation shows lipid layer enhancers win when product format, formulation choices, and channel strategy align tightly with distinct user routines and needs
Key segmentation insights reveal that competitive advantage in lipid layer enhancers depends on how product design aligns with use setting, user intent, and clinical guidance. Across product type, lipid-heavy emulsions and hybrid formulations that pair lipids with complementary moisturizers are increasingly positioned to address evaporative symptoms and post-screen discomfort, while more minimalist lipid sprays and adjunct formats appeal to routines that prioritize speed and minimal vision disruption. This is driving brands to clarify when a product is intended as a primary tear film stabilizer versus a supportive companion to other dry eye therapies.Differences by dosage form and delivery mechanism are equally decisive. Drops remain the anchor because they fit established patient behavior, yet they compete on tolerability, blur profile, and frequency of use. Sprays and wipes can serve patients who struggle with instillation, wear eye makeup, or want on-the-go convenience, but they must overcome skepticism about efficacy and proper use. As a result, education-led commercialization is becoming a core capability, with instructions, demonstrations, and clinician reinforcement shaping adherence and repurchase.
From an ingredient and formulation perspective, the segmentation highlights a widening spread between preservative-free and preserved systems, and between standard emulsifiers and newer approaches designed to reduce irritation. Preservative-free choices often resonate with chronic users and those with sensitivity, but they also carry packaging and cost implications that can influence channel strategy. Meanwhile, products differentiated by lipid source and stability profile are increasingly being evaluated by clinicians who want fewer trade-offs between comfort and performance.
Channel segmentation underscores a clear divergence in how value is created. Pharmacy and clinic-adjacent pathways reward medical credibility, clear indications, and professional recommendation. Mass retail emphasizes shelf clarity and brand recognition. E-commerce thrives on education content, reviews, and replenishment convenience, but it also increases exposure to comparison shopping and margin pressure. Finally, end-user segmentation suggests that newly symptomatic users often choose accessible, broadly positioned products, whereas chronic sufferers and contact lens wearers prioritize consistency, preservative considerations, and compatibility with daily routines.
Taken together, segmentation insights point to a portfolio design imperative: winning brands map each SKU to a specific user problem and context, reduce ambiguity in the “why this product” message, and ensure the packaging and sensory experience reinforce the intended use pattern.
Regional performance varies with channel power, climate and screen exposure, and regulatory norms across the Americas, EMEA, and Asia-Pacific markets
Regional dynamics for lipid layer enhancers are shaped by healthcare access patterns, consumer purchasing behavior, regulatory expectations, and environmental factors that influence dry eye symptoms. In the Americas, strong consumer health infrastructure and high awareness of screen-related discomfort support broad retail and online demand, while clinician influence remains central for patients with persistent symptoms. This combination encourages brands to maintain a clear bridge between over-the-counter convenience and medically credible positioning.In Europe, Middle East & Africa, the landscape is more heterogeneous. Western European markets often emphasize preservative-free and tolerability-driven choices, with pharmacy channels and professional recommendation playing a prominent role. At the same time, parts of the Middle East face climatic conditions that can exacerbate evaporative symptoms, making tear film stabilization narratives particularly resonant when paired with culturally appropriate education. Across Africa, access variability can shift demand toward widely available formats and affordability-conscious portfolio decisions, especially where distribution complexity affects consistent supply.
In Asia-Pacific, growth in digital consumption, urban pollution exposure, and expanding middle-class spending power are shaping a fast-evolving category. Consumers in several markets are highly receptive to functional product claims and convenient routines, which can accelerate uptake of innovative formats when supported by trusted brands and clear usage guidance. However, success often hinges on navigating diverse regulatory pathways and localized channel structures, including strong roles for pharmacies, online marketplaces, and clinic-linked dispensing.
Across regions, a common thread is the rising importance of education and compliance-ready messaging. Consumers are increasingly savvy, but the category remains complex; not every dry eye complaint is the same, and lipid layer enhancers can be misunderstood as interchangeable with standard lubricants. Regional winners adapt claims, packaging, and professional engagement to local expectations while maintaining global quality consistency and supply reliability.
Company advantage is consolidating around formulation performance, clinician-trusted evidence and messaging, and resilient packaging-enabled manufacturing execution
Key company insights indicate that competition is increasingly defined by three capabilities: formulation excellence, credible clinical communication, and supply chain discipline. Leading participants differentiate by optimizing droplet size, emulsion stability, and comfort profile to minimize blur and burning while sustaining tear film coverage. Those technical decisions translate directly into brand trust, particularly among chronic users who quickly abandon products that feel inconsistent from bottle to bottle.Another differentiator is how effectively companies translate science into compliant, persuasive messaging. High-performing firms invest in professional education, ensuring that eye care practitioners can articulate why lipid supplementation matters for evaporative symptoms and how to integrate these products alongside lid hygiene, thermal therapies, or anti-inflammatory regimens when appropriate. In consumer channels, the same firms simplify the story without oversimplifying the science, using clearer language around tear evaporation, screen strain, and day-long comfort.
Packaging and manufacturing strategies also separate leaders from followers. Preservative-free offerings, whether single-dose or advanced multi-dose, require strong engineering controls and dependable component sourcing. Companies that have qualified alternate suppliers, strengthened quality systems, and built redundancy into critical inputs are better positioned to maintain availability during trade disruptions or capacity constraints. Meanwhile, brands that treat packaging as part of user experience-easy-to-squeeze bottles, precise drop control, and travel-friendly formats-often see stronger repeat purchasing.
Finally, partnership behavior is evolving. Co-development with device makers, collaborations with clinic networks, and selective licensing of novel delivery technologies are becoming more common as companies seek to accelerate differentiation. This reinforces an important point for decision-makers: the competitive moat is no longer built solely on having a lipid-containing formula; it is built on an integrated system of performance, proof, and reliable delivery to the end user.
